Output 3e3fb9e5b81e517cc6d0eaeaf6faa355fea1c30d4cfb0f77b2fc51d2f1a4088a:2

value
420014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ebaf20ef6d47b3d36f2b64ba8c27ebb024f778a OP_EQUAL
address
37Qhme92RGpZGvhpDgUhawcnrdxPbEc2Md
transaction
3e3fb9e5b81e517cc6d0eaeaf6faa355fea1c30d4cfb0f77b2fc51d2f1a4088a
confirmations
264224
spent
true